    What to do if my Kodak HERO 9.1 All in One Printer is not detected?
    • M
      Melanie HudsonAug 25, 2025
      To resolve the issue of your Kodak All in One Printer not being detected, ensure it is plugged in and powered on. If using a USB connection, verify it's a USB 2.0 high-speed cable connected to both the printer and computer. Restart your computer if the USB cable was reconnected or power was interrupted. For wireless connections, confirm the Wi-Fi LED is lit and the printer is connected to your network. Check the network configuration on the printer to ensure the Active Connection Type is Wi-Fi and the IP Address is not all zeros. Also, verify that your router is transmitting data and that your firewall settings (excluding WINDOWS Firewall) are allowing the necessary services for the printer.

    How to prevent paper curl in Kodak All in One Printer?
    • E
      Erica DodsonSep 3, 2025
      To reduce paper curl after printing with your Kodak All in One Printer, especially when printing pictures or documents with large image areas, increase the top and bottom margins when printing in portrait mode, or the left and right margins in landscape mode. Try using a heavier paper, such as 24 lb (90 gsm) paper or KODAK Ultimate Paper. Apply a border instead of printing in borderless mode. If the paper is not stacking properly in the output tray, remove the pages as they exit.
